Anton Boari

Job Titles:
  • Coach & Guide
Anton started kayaking on the sea as a teenager on an old fiberglass sit on top that his dad picked up in a second hand shop and restored. He then started working at various outdoor centers across the UK and trained to become an instructor in many outdoor sports including both kayaking and canoeing. In 2004 Anton moved to London to manage a government funded youth project aimed at training young people to become instructors themselves in kayaking, canoeing and climbing; it was here that he trained to become a British Canoeing level 3 Sea Kayak coach. Since then he's paddled all over the UK including Anglesey, Cornwall, Isle of Skye, to name but a few and some big tidal crossings like Jersey to the isle of Sark. Anton has worked as an instructor in China, Australia and in the United Arab Emirates where he worked for a year leading military groups on multi day kayaking and mountain walking expeditions. Anton has also enjoyed a lot of White Water paddling in the UK but his biggest achievement was the Sun Koshi river in Nepal which was an 8 day expedition traveling 240km paddling one of the worlds highest volume rivers.

Ben Brierley - Founder

Job Titles:
  • Coach
  • Founder
  • Instructor
Ben has Irish origins but grew up in the adventure playground of the far North of Scotland. He started kayaking seriously in 1993 and has led many exciting expeditions around the world, from an unsupported kayak crossing of the Irish Sea to wilderness journeys on extreme white water rivers in the Himalayas. Ben has worked year round, full time, as an outdoor leader/coach since 1997 and holds the highest British leader qualification in both sea and river kayak. Ben grew up on the sea and is also a sailing instructor and holds a commercial boat masters licence. He spent 10 years running a survival training centre on a remote uninhabited island in the north west of Scotland teaching people how to live off the land as well as kayaking, mountaineering and expedition skills. During the winter months he runs a ski school (Momentum Snowsports) in the famous French resort of Courchevel, he also holds the highest level of ski instructor qualification. Elisabeth Hadley

Job Titles:
  • Instructor
  • Coach & Guide
Elisabeth started canoeing in her teens in the Lake District during summer holidays, paddling on Lake Coniston. Later at Bristol Polytechnic she joined Bristol Canoe Club and started getting seriously into white water kayaking. Eventually her profession as a sculptor and artist led her to a move further south to Brixham. It was here, through the Ibex Canoe Club, that Elisabeth discovered a passion for sea kayaking, participating in many club trips and also getting into coaching as a way of putting something back into the sport. Elisabeth has paddled white water on many of the UK's best rivers, as well as some of the French Alps classics. Her sea kayaking has taken her from Devon and Cornwall and the Isles of Scilly, through North Wales and Scotland, and all the way to New Zealand. Some of her more notable achievements include a crossing to Lundy Island and back, kayaking the entire Devon and Cornish coastline, circumnavigating Anglesey in two days, and exploring the stunning Isles of Scilly.

Lee Waters

Job Titles:
  • Coach & Guide
  • Freelance Coach & Guide
Lee is a former Royal Marines Commando with a background of white water and Kayak marathon racing. He has completed the gruelling Devizes to Westminster race four times. He also paddled as part of the Queens Diamond Jubilee pageant on the Thames in Sea Kayaks, and this is where Lee believes his Sea Kayak obsession began. Lee then paddled the English Channel as part of the 350th anniversary of the Royal Marines and continues to support paddle sports in the military. Lee is an ISKGA Advanced Guide and BC Advanced Sea Leader as well as a level 3 Sea Kayak Coach, Personal Performance Provider and Sea Leader provider. A passionate wildlife enthusiast Lee is a strong advocate of the leave no trace policy and provides informative and fun alternative culinary and fire lighting experiences from a Sea Kayak. Lee has guided on expeditions in Norway, France, Cyprus, and the UK
